Rebecca Vigen is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Surgery and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Rebecca Vigen has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 4 papers in Surgery and 3 papers in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ine. Recurrent topics in Rebecca Vigen's work include Acute Myocardial Infarction Research (6 papers), Blood Pressure and Hypertension Studies (5 papers) and Heart Failure Treatment and Management (3 papers). Rebecca Vigen is often cited by papers focused on Acute Myocardial Infarction Research (6 papers), Blood Pressure and Hypertension Studies (5 papers) and Heart Failure Treatment and Management (3 papers). Rebecca Vigen collaborates with scholars based in United States and Norway. Rebecca Vigen's co-authors include Thomas M. Maddox, Larry A. Allen, Colby Ayers, Thomas M. Maddox, John S. Rumsfeld, Tamára L. Box, Stephan D. Fihn, Mary E. Plomondon, James Brian Byrd and James A. de Lemos and has published in prestigious journals such as JAMA, Journal of the American College of Cardiology and Scientific Reports.
